I bought my iPhone 6 two weeks ago at the T-Mobile store, and have been thinking of buying AppleCare. I just jailbroke my iPhone though. Do they check anything to make sure it's good?
I went to the store and bought AC+ after buying my iPhone 6 new from Swappa. The guy just jotted a few numbers down. I paid and I was on my way. I think it was the IMEI number.
Apple sales needs the serial number so they will go to Settings > General > About.
When I got apple care + 2 days after I got my phone, apple sale never inspected my phone. All they did was went straight to the About page for the serial number.
the dont care if its jailbroken, ive taken a phone back that had faulty hardware, it was jailbroken at the time I took it back and they traded it in right then for a new one.
